Posted on September 28, 2011, 05:11 PM by Joey SantosusUFC Light Heavyweight Champion Jon "Bones" Jones, alongside head coach Greg Jackson, opens the doors to the Jackson's MMA training center in Albuquerque, New Mexico, granting an inside look at the champ's preparation for his UFC 135 title defense against Quinton "Rampage" Jackson.
In the end, the training camp produced positive results for Jones, who went on to defeat "Rampage in dominate fashion, marking the first of what many expect to be several successful title defenses for the 24-year-old. Up next for "Bones" will be his former friend and teammate Rashad Evans, though no date for bout has been set at this time. Props: MMAFighting.com
